Re: apt-get upgrade woes



On Thu, Nov 08, 2001 at 09:29:57PM +0100, J.H.M. Dassen (Ray) wrote:
>On Thu, Nov 08, 2001 at 20:07:04 +0000, P Kirk wrote:
>> install-info: failed to lock dir for editing! Operation not permitted
>
>Weird. link(2) lists only two possible causes for EPERM:
>"The filesystem containing oldpath and newpath does not support the creation
>of hard links." and "oldpath is a directory.".
>
>What does "ls -ld /usr/info/dir" say?

[~]: ls -ld /usr/info/
drwxr-xr-x    2 root     root         4096 Nov  9 10:23 /usr/info//
[~]: ls -la /usr/info/
total 8
drwxr-xr-x    2 root     root         4096 Nov  9 10:23 ./
drwxrwxrwx   17 root     root         4096 Nov  6 15:33 ../
-rw-rw-rw-    2 root     root            0 Nov  9 09:33 dir
-rw-rw-rw-    2 root     root            0 Nov  9 09:33 dir.lock

/usr/info/dir was indeed a directory.  I had mkdir-ed info and
info/dir to try and make this thing work.  I've deleted it and now
touch-ed info/dir

Still doesn't work though.  New file access log attached...I
Control-C-ed at 6537 as it hangs there indefinitely.

Please let me know what you think.
